I plant jungle trees and don't worry about bone meal because I always have mature trees to farm at any point. I currently have 5 jungle trees and I get about 5 saplings each time I fell one (so I will slowly grow to 6 trees and so on and so forth.) I replant it immediately and move on. It grows back after a few days and it's ready for the next harvest whenever I need it. And cutting them down it a breeze, just climb to the top, crouch, look down and start chopping while rotating. I can bring down a jungle tree in less than a minute and I have more wood than I need for almost any project.

Use a ladder and push them up. Create a chute/hallway with the ladder at the end. Make sure your ladder is enclosed on both sides or the villager will slide off to one side. Once you have two villagers on the top level you can just breed them for the balance.
